Browser-based developer and everyday utilities served from a single Cloudflare Worker.
SimpleTool is a collection of web utilities for formatting data, inspecting security artifacts, working with network formats, generating values, and transforming text or media. The Cloudflare Worker renders and routes the pages; tool input and output are processed in the browser.
The production catalog contains 47 tools. Three additional game tools are registered (50 total) but hidden unless the Worker runs in a development environment.
- Browser-side processing for tool data, with no application accounts or server-side tool-data storage.
- Utilities for JSON, YAML, TOML, SQL, Markdown, regular expressions, text diffs, images, SVG, colors, timestamps, and units.
- Security and inspection tools for passwords, SSH keys, X.509 certificates, SAML, OAuth/PKCE, tokens, CSP, secrets, and environment files.
- Network references and builders for CIDR, DNS records, ports, HTTP status codes, protocol headers, Wireshark filters, WireGuard, webhooks, and curl.
- Registry-driven routing, home-page discovery, related-tool links, and production visibility.
- Responsive light and dark themes built with Tailwind CSS.
- Localization for English, Korean, Japanese, Spanish, Simplified Chinese, Traditional Chinese, French, German, Portuguese, and Vietnamese.
- Nonce-based Content Security Policy headers and IP-based rate limiting, backed by a Durable Object with an in-memory fallback.
- Unit tests with Vitest, browser tests with Playwright, and automated accessibility checks with axe-core.

src/utils/tool-registry.js is the source of truth for the tool catalog. scripts/build-routes.js generates the route-handler map, and the remaining build scripts compile Tailwind CSS, bundle browser dependencies, generate the Open Graph image, and prepare static assets in dist/.

To deploy interactively, authenticate Wrangler first:
bunx wrangler login
bun run deployProduction deployment is also automated by .github/workflows/deploy.yml for pushes to main. The workflow builds, runs unit and E2E tests, performs a Wrangler dry run, deploys, and smoke-tests representative routes.
Cloudflare Worker settings are defined in wrangler.toml. The checked-in defaults disable AdSense, Sentry reporting, and Cloudflare Web Analytics until their values are configured.
| Variable | Purpose |
|---|---|
ENVIRONMENT |
Set to development, dev, or local to disable ads and production rate limiting and to include development-only tools. |
SITE_URL |
Base URL used for canonical links; defaults to https://simpletool.app. |
ADSENSE_CLIENT |
AdSense publisher client ID in ca-pub-<digits> format. Ads stay off until slot IDs exist. |
ADSENSE_SLOT |
Optional fallback slot ID for the allow-list keys (home, json, legal). |
ADSENSE_SLOTS |
JSON object with home, json, and/or legal slot IDs. Empty {} keeps ad units off; ads.txt still ships if ADSENSE_CLIENT is set. |
SENTRY_DSN |
Enables Sentry error reporting when non-empty. |
CF_ANALYTICS_TOKEN |
Enables the Cloudflare Web Analytics beacon when non-empty. |
For local overrides, place values in the ignored .dev.vars file. Do not commit credentials or private deployment values.

playwright.config.js supports these test-runner variables:
| Variable | Behavior |
|---|---|
PW_BASE_URL |
Overrides the URL used by browser tests. |
PW_PORT |
Overrides the local Worker port; defaults to 8787. |
PW_NO_WEB_SERVER=1 |
Prevents Playwright from starting its managed local Worker. |
PW_SKIP_BUILD=1 |
Skips the build in Playwright's managed server command. CI uses this when testing a prepared build artifact. |
PW_USE_SYSTEM_CHROME=1 |
Runs tests with the installed Chrome channel instead of bundled Chromium. |
Run a build before unit tests that import route or shared UI modules because bun run build generates src/routes/_handlers.js, src/utils/bundled-styles.js, and files under dist/.

Route pages are HTML template literals. Regular-expression backslashes inside those templates must be doubled so the browser receives the intended expression. Files using String.raw are the exception.

- Tool inputs and outputs are handled by browser-side code. Requests for pages and static assets still pass through Cloudflare and may produce normal infrastructure logs.
- AdSense and Cloudflare Web Analytics can make third-party requests when configured in production.
- The Worker applies CSP, HSTS, clickjacking, MIME-sniffing, referrer, permissions, and cross-origin headers.
- The default request limit is 120 requests per minute per IP, or 240 for recognized shared-IP networks. Rate limiting is disabled in development environments.
- Algorithms such as MD5 and SHA-1 remain available for compatibility and inspection workflows; they should not be used for new security-sensitive designs.
